Sorry, we'll try again here - My wife and I also got back on May 17th from EDR for our honeymoon. We had read alot of negative reviews but decided to go with the place because of some very positive ones.
We loved this place and did not want to leave! The resort is beautiful and the service is outstanding. The service staff was very well trained; as a restaurant manager, I know good service. I wish we could be pampered by these folks at the restaurants we dine at in Austin.They try very hard to please ,and never seem to be expecting a tip(we did anyways). I literally had to chase the room service guy down the stairs to give him some money.
The food is, overall, very good. I would recommend upon arrival you resist the urge to hit the beach and make reservations at the Italian and Mexican restaurants. Both were very good; Ernesto @ the Italian provided some of the best service I have ever recieved in my life. There are some things that are kind of funky; you are in Mexico.
The waitstaff wore hairnets and the kitchen staff wore surgeons masks.We did NOT get sick.
I recommend this place to anyone wanting to get away from it all.We did talk to a couple who got married there and said everything was perfect.
I will go back.

: : : FYI! My girlfriend and I just returned from EDR on 3/5/01 and they are screwing people left and right.
: : : It seems they "lost" all of their reservations and by the time they found them they had seriously overbooked the resort. Now they are meeting people at the airport and sending them to stay in other resorts for a day or two before they will put you up. They put us and six other couples up at the Omini in Cancun for the first night we were there. Then, the van that was supposed to pick us up in the morning only had room for 10 people. How they could do this when they knew how many people they sent out there, I don't know. We spent a half an hour arguing with the van driver that we wouldn't ride on the floor of the van - go figure. After jumping in a taxi - which the resort grumbly paid for - we arrived to a lobby full of angry pissed off people, no champagne greeting, NO greeting at all.
: : : People with Casita reservations had to downgrade until a Casita came open. Some people with a Mini suite or regular room had to stay in their "holding" rooms with no view of the ocean at all. The resort tried to pacify people with $150 certificates (per room) to the spa, but it turned out that all spa services were booked by the time we got there. Not only that, but the resort was so full that all dinner reservations were booked as well (I think we got a 6 pm at the Mexican restaurant). The worst part of all of this was not that the resort screwed up, but their nonchalant attitude and inability (or caring) to compensate for this absolute mess. I have more but I feel like I'm rambling. The resort is beautiful, but it hardly makes up for the lack of service and unprofessional attitude of the staff. If you are leaving for the EDR, CALL YOUR TRAVEL AGENT TODAY and have them check on this terrible situation. You might even want to consider changing your plans.
